The Mas'erton Repatriation Committee, at its meeting on Thursday, approved; nine loan? for furniture, involving an. aggregate sum of ~£431 lGs. 2d. Two applications for admission to the ffairarapa,! training farm wero approved. Two men, were granted subsidies on their wngCA,: and it was decided to pay tho fees for a soldier who was learning motor en-; gineering at the Technical bcliool.
